Outline of Final Research Achievements |
We have constructed a queueing network model for the patient flow over several wards in the obstetric unit of the University of Tsukuba Hospital, and succeeded in predicting the probabilistic distribution for the number of patients staying in each ward from the statistics of their admission rate and length of stay. Also, for Yokohama Minami-Kyosai Hospital, we have proposed and tested a semi-automatic method for converting doctor’s order of surgical operation with patient’s information into a succinct phrase to be displayed in a weekly scheduling table of the operating rooms. In addition, we have studied relevant queueing theory for analyzing multi-server, priority queues of impatient customers.
